Magnetic phase diagram of Ca_1-xMn_xO
S. Kolesnik, B. Dabrowski

TL;DR
This study maps the magnetic phase diagram of Ca$_{1-x}$Mn$_x$O, revealing how magnetic order evolves with Mn content, transitioning from spin-glass to antiferromagnetic states, with different transition orders.
Contribution
It provides the first detailed magnetic phase diagram of Ca$_{1-x}$Mn$_x$O, identifying the nature of magnetic transitions across various Mn concentrations.
Findings
Magnetic order shifts from spin-glass to antiferromagnetic with increasing Mn.
Transitions are second order for 0.5 ≤ x ≤ 0.65 and first order for x ≥ 0.7.
High-temperature susceptibility fits a diluted Heisenberg magnet model.
Abstract
Alternating current susceptibility and direct current magnetization have been studied for polycrystalline CaMnO. On increasing the Mn content, magnetic ordering changes from spin-glass behavior for to antiferromagnetic order. The paramagnetic/antiferromagnetic transition is of second order for and of first order for . For low Mn concentrations, the high-temperature alternating current susceptibility can be described by a diluted Heisenberg magnet model developed for diluted magnetic semiconductors.
